Where standard motorised blinds leak light

Every standard motorised roller blind has four edges where light gets around the fabric. The MAB frame is designed to close those edges.

Top edge

The roller mechanism sits in brackets, with a gap between the fabric and the wall above. The MAB pelmet covers this gap.

Left edge

Standard rollers don’t have side channels. The MAB side track runs the full height of the window, sealed against the reveal.

Right edge

Same as the left. Two side tracks lock the fabric edges so no light comes around the sides.

Bottom edge

Standard rollers have a small gap between the bottom rail and the windowsill. The MAB sealed bottom rail closes it.

SmartHub for voice and app control

Connect the MAB system to your home Wi-Fi and operate it through your phone, Google Home, Alexa or Amazon Home.

Not sure your window will fit the framed system?

Single systems usually need around 70 mm reveal depth at the top. Dual systems need around 90 mm. Send a photo if you’re not sure — we’ll confirm before you order.

Rechargeable. No electrician needed.

USB-C charging

Charge the motor the same way you charge a phone. Cable included with every system.

Long-lasting battery

Top-up each change of season as a habit. Battery designed to last well between charges with typical daily use.

No hardwiring

No electrician, no exposed cables, no power point near the blind. The motor lives inside the frame.
